The challenge in this Petition is to an order dated 4 September 2024 passed by the learned Civil Judge, Sr. Division, Panvel, on an application (Exhibit 119) for framing additional issues, whereby the said application came to be rejected observing, inter alia, that the Plaintiffs had not filed draft issues. 3.
From the perusal of the application (Exhibit 119) it appears that a vague application was filed by the Plaintiffs seeking settlement of the additional issues, pursuant to the amendment in the written statement. It also appears that the Defendants had not seriously objected to the framing of the additional issues, provided such issues were warranted consequent to the amendment in the written statement.

It appears that on account of the vague nature of the application, the SSP 1/2
20 wp 18209 of 2024.doc learned Civil Judge was not equipped to apply his mind to the necessity of the framing of additional issues pursuant to the amendment in the written statement. It is true, the learned Civil Judge had also observed that he was of the opinion that no additional issues need to be framed. Yet, in these circumstances, it may be expedient to permit the Petitioner to file a fresh application for settlement of additional issues, within a stipulated period. In the event such an application is filed, the learned Civil Judge shall decide the same in accordance with law.
